Dispute over train horns before station pedestrian crossings has February court hearing

An effort to force the MBTA to sound train horns at every pedestrian crossing that cuts through a station is heading to a showdown next month in Suffolk County Superior Court when lawyers will argue over whether a former train operator has standing to go after the public transit agency.

Fight over train horns before station pedestrian crossings taken to highest state court

After the 2019 death of Emerson College professor Moses Shumow, a lawyer has been working to get state agencies to require trains to sound their horns before pedestrian crossings inside stations. On Monday, he took the fight to the state's highest court.
